centos7 nginx配置ssl證書實現https訪問同時http訪問


1,首先將你申請到的nginx 分類下的ssl證書上傳到nginx的config下(可以新建一個目錄叫ssl。)

2.修改nginx的config配置

server {
listen 80;(監聽80端口)
listen 443 ssl;(監聽443端口,阿里服務器在安全組開放443端口)
server_name www.zjrzb.cn;(此處改為你的域名)

####端口轉發配置
location / {
proxy_pass http://127.0.0.1:8090;
proxy_set_header Host $host:80;
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
}
ssl_certificate ssl/1_zjrzb.cn_bundle.crt;(此處修改為你上傳的nginx分類的crt文件路徑)
ssl_certificate_key ssl/2_zjrzb.cn.key;(此處修改為你上傳的key文件路徑)
ssl_session_timeout 5m;
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
ssl_ciphers AESGCM:ALL:!DH:!EXPORT:!RC4:+HIGH:!MEDIUM:!LOW:!aNULL:!eNULL;
ssl_prefer_server_ciphers on;
}

3.重啟nginx就ok了


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M